University Community Farmers Market The University Community Farmers Market began in 2007 as a community event to bring fresh produce and market goods and support local business in the neighborhood. Each year more vendors and events are added to make the market an enjoyable community gathering place for all. This market is a collaboration between the University at Buffalo, the surrounding South Campus neighborhoods and local organizations to promote wellness and community sustainability through the availability of fresh produce and locally grown food while promoting local entrepreneurs.
